d-Matrix · 4 months ago
Software Engineering, Senior Director - Kernels
d-Matrix is focused on unleashing the potential of generative AI to power the transformation of technology. They are seeking a Senior Director of Software Engineering to lead the development, enhancement, and maintenance of software kernels for next-generation AI hardware, collaborating with experts across software and hardware domains.
Artificial Intelligence (AI)Cloud InfrastructureData CenterSemiconductor
Responsibilities
Be part of the team that helps productize the SW stack for our AI compute engine
Responsible for the development, enhancement, and maintenance of software kernels for next-generation AI hardware
Possess experience building software kernels for HW architectures
Strong understanding of various hardware architectures and how to map algorithms to the architecture
Understand how to map computational graphs generated by AI frameworks to the underlying architecture
Work across all aspects of the full stack tool chain and understand the nuances of hardware-software co-design
Build and scale software deliverables in a tight development window
Work with a team of compiler experts to build out the compiler infrastructure working closely with other software (ML, Systems) and hardware (mixed signal, DSP, CPU) experts
Qualification
Required
MS or PhD in Computer Engineering, Math, Physics or related degree with 12+ years of industry experience
Strong grasp of computer architecture, data structures, system software, and machine learning fundamentals
Proficient in C/C++ and Python development in Linux environment and using standard development tools
Experience implementing algorithms in high level languages such as C/C++, Python
Experience implementing algorithms for specialized hardware such as FPGAs, DSPs, GPUs, AI accelerators using libraries such as CuDA etc
Experience in implementing operators commonly used in ML workloads - GEMMs, Convolutions, BLAS, SIMD operators for operations like softmax, layer normalization, pooling etc
Experience with development for embedded SIMD vector processors such as Tensilica
Self-motivated team player with a strong sense of ownership and leadership
Preferred
Prior startup, small team or incubation experience
Experience with ML frameworks such as TensorFlow and/or PyTorch
Experience working with ML compilers and algorithms, such as MLIR, LLVM, TVM, Glow, etc
Experience with a deep learning framework (such as PyTorch, Tensorflow) and ML models for CV, NLP, or Recommendation
Work experience at a cloud provider or AI compute / sub-system company
Company
d-Matrix
D-Matrix is a platform that enables data centers to handle large-scale generative AI inference with high throughput and low latency.
H1B Sponsorship
d-Matrix has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(20)
2024 (15)
2023 (8)
2022 (7)
Funding
Current Stage
Growth StageTotal Funding
$429MKey Investors
Temasek HoldingsTSVC
2025-11-12Series C· $275M
2023-09-06Series B· $110M
2022-04-20Series A· $44M
Recent News
2025-12-22
2025-12-17
Crunchbase News
2025-12-10
Company data provided by crunchbase